Cheap inks are pretty good for most stuff, although the colours are questionable at times and longevity of the prints are not as good as they have a tendancy to fade much sooner than the canon/hp/epson ones.  

Anything you want to put in an album I would just use an online service like Photobox.  Although for day to day stuff, the 3rd party ones cannot be beaten.

I found that laminating them can help a bit as the inks oxidise in air, got the idea from a photographic magazine article. It also stops grubby little hands smearing the ink all over the place.
